#15c288 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15c288 is composed of 8.2% red, 76.1%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.9%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 159.9 degrees, a saturation of 80.5% and a lightness of 42.2%. #15c288 color hex could be obtained by blending #2affff with #008511.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#15c288 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#15c288 has RGB values of R:21, G:194,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 1426056.
